Colorado Civil Group, Inc. (CCG) was founded in January 2007 by David Huwa, Dave Lindsay, and Chris Messersmith—three engineers who left a larger engineering firm with a shared vision: to build a company where client service, quality, and communication were the top priorities. Motivated by a desire to work more efficiently and cultivate stronger, trust-based relationships, they established CCG in the heart of Northern Colorado. Today, the firm has grown to include nine civil engineers, seven of whom are full-time licensed professionals, along with one part-time licensed engineer. CCG specializes in civil engineering design and construction administration for public entities, including municipalities, school districts, and water and fire districts. The team has built strong working relationships with local agencies, serving as the Town Engineer for Severance and the water infrastructure engineer for Firestone. CCG has completed or is actively working on over 80 school district projects across the region, involving everything from roadways and storm drainage to potable water and sanitary sewer systems.
